[QUOTE="Dexter, post: 2082666, member: 1978"] Trying to sort out the actual rule for SoO eligibility if anyone has a link. I have looked but can't find anything. I think the rule states a player is eligible to play for the state where he played his first footy after the age of 16. Inglis played his first footy at 17 in a QLD comp making him eligible for QLD. There is footage on youtube with commentary from Dany Weidler suggesting because he played arrive alive cup at 16 he is qualified for NSW. I guess the question is what is the definition of "after the age of 16", is it 16 and 1 day or is it 17 and over. Good to find the site again by the way.
